
Mazzone
Mazzone is a unique name with Italian origins, often meaning 'big or powerful'. It is not commonly used as a first name but is associated with surnames in Italian culture. The name evokes a sense of strength and prominence, drawing from its etymological roots.
In terms of perception, Mazzone carries distinct Italian flair, often admired for its musicality and elegance. Although more frequently seen as a surname, its application as a first name gives it a modern touch.
While less prominent in popular culture, Mazzone reflects a noble character trait. Overall, it symbolizes authority and charisma, making it a distinctive choice for parents seeking something uncommon yet resonant.

Mazzone Popularity
Mazzone Usage and Popularity By Country
Country | Rank (Overall) |
---|---|
Italy | 6929 |
Bolivia | 10554 |
Switzerland | 22775 |
Sweden | 31840 |
Thailand | 60600 |
Spain | 63520 |
France | 72677 |
Germany | 81441 |
United States | 164599 |
United Kingdom | 182431 |
